As we approach autumn there are more and more dead cicadas littering the pavements, but I am also now discovering different types. These guys are a little smaller and rather more gruesome than the ones so prevalent in early August. Noise remains the same however!

Most of the time their buzzing is considered as a natural noise in summer and people find it relaxing to hear, but in places such as parks they can get so loud that it really hurts your ears! We’re talking about up to 120 dB! Technically that’s loud enough to cause permanent hearing loss in humans!
